问题标签 [rhodes]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
2 回答
413 浏览

iphone - 测试/构建 RhoHub 应用程序需要用于 Mac 的官方 iPhone SDK?

我在这方面看到了相互矛盾的信息。如果我使用RhoHub (Rhodes) 构建 iPhone 应用程序,我是否需要在我面前有一台 Mac 或使用他们的 SDK 和某种虚拟化技巧?或者 Rhodes 是否包含用于测试/部署的本机 Windows 解决方案?

我目前在 Windows XP 环境中。

0 投票
3 回答
273 浏览

frameworks - 智能手机和网站的应用程序开发?

我一直在研究移动开发框架,包括 Rhodes、Titanium 和 PhoneGap。由于我们正在开发的应用程序的很大一部分也将集成到网络上(游戏),我们希望重用代码,以免重新发明轮子。有没有最好的方法来做到这一点?有没有一个框架可以让你开发不仅仅是智能手机设备?我以为我记得看到过一个,但我一辈子都不记得那是什么了。

谢谢, - 马特

0 投票
1 回答
445 浏览

rhomobile - RhoMobile LOV(值列表)

有谁知道如何在 RhoMobile 应用程序中实现 LOV(值列表)搜索?
我需要放置一个包含客户代码的字段,用户可以通过输入客户的姓名找到代码,这是一千多个可能值中的一个。

提前致谢。

0 投票
2 回答
238 浏览

ruby - ""(两个双引号)在 Ruby 中有什么作用?

我见过一行只有两个双引号(“”)的 Ruby 代码。那条线有什么作用?

0 投票
1 回答
1826 浏览

ruby - Rhomobile Rhodes 应用程序中的页面导航问题

在模型的页面上,我显示了两个链接“选择图片”和“拍照”。选择图片后,我成功返回该页面,并且选择的图像正确显示。但是,当我单击“拍照”时,相机打开,我拍照,调用页面加载显示的图像,然后立即显示该模型中的索引页面。

这两个程序都是相同的,只是一个调用“take_picture”,另一个调用“choose_picture”,有人能告诉我为什么在第二种情况下应用程序重定向到模型中的索引页面吗?

abc_controller.rb:

调用页面:mypage.bb.erb

================

日志:

我 09/09/2010 07:23:08:83 7a934000 RHO PropertyCon| 布局文件:/apps/app/layout_erb.iseq。内容大小:2202

我 09/09/2010 07:23:08:83 7a934000 应用程序| RhoApplication: 使用菜单 - {"Home"=>:home, Refresh"=>:refresh, "Sync"=>:sync,"Options"=>:options, "Log"=>:log, :separator=>nil , "关闭"=>:关闭}

我 09/09/2010 07:23:08:83 7a934000 RhoConnection| 调度结束

我 09/09/2010 07:23:08:161 7a934000 RhoConnection| 调度开始

我 09/09/2010 07:23:08:223 7a934000 应用程序| RhoApplication: 使用菜单 - {"Home"=>:home, "Refresh"=>:refresh, "Sync"=>:sync, "Options"=>:options, "Log"=>:log, :separator=>无,“关闭”=>:关闭}

我 09/09/2010 07:23:08:223 7a934000 应用程序| 在 RHO.serve_index 内:/apps/app/index_erb.iseq

我 09/09/2010 07:23:08:223 7a934000 RHO Rho::RhoCon| inst_render_index

0 投票
2 回答
176 浏览

signing - 适用于 BlackBerry 的 Rhodes 应用签名

我读到黑莓签名密钥只能安装在一台 PC 上。

我正在一台 PC 上编译我的 Rhomobile Rhodes 应用程序。但是 BlackBerry 签名密钥安装在另一台 PC 上。为了在另一台 PC 上签署应用程序,我需要做什么。

PS:我已经将 bbsignpwd 设置在rhobuild.yml.

0 投票
1 回答
339 浏览

mobile - 在 rhomobile 中解压缩文件和/或流

如何在 rhomobile 应用程序中解压缩压缩文件?
我看到 zlib 扩展在 rhodes 中不可用,因为它需要一个 ruby​​ 端口。Ruby 使用“zlib.c”或“zlib.h”源文件,而不是可移植的 zlib。

运行 rhodes 应用程序时,与源码一致:

它引发了错误:

有人有什么想法吗?

提前致谢?

0 投票
3 回答
1165 浏览

javascript - 编写手机电台应用程序——Javascript/HTML/CSS 可行,还是我们需要原生?

我想编写一个应用程序,将 MP3 从服务器流式传输到美国三大智能手机操作系统(iPhone、Blackberry 和 Android)中的任何一个。

这是我关心的权衡:如果我在本地编写应用程序,它将带来最佳的用户体验,并让我能够根据需要添加更多功能,但我将拥有 3 个独立的代码库,这违反了干燥原则。

如果我使用其中一个框架用 Javascript/HTML 编写它(例如Rhomobile Rhodes),那么我有一个适用于所有主要平台的代码库,所以我没有违反 DRY 并且开发过程在这方面更简单,但是a)用户体验会受到影响,b)我用SoundManager在iPhone上用Javascript播放MP3文件做了一些简单的测试,它立即开始糟糕(例如“酷,我可以玩”之后的第二阶段实验MP3”是“我无法访问 ID3 标签?这太糟糕了。”)。

我想知道是否有人在开发多个移动平台方面有经验可以证实或否定我的印象:使用 Javascript 和 HTML 进行跨平台开发是否可行(特别是对于多媒体应用程序)?还是“开发和维护三个独立的本机代码库”是要走的路?

提前致谢。

编辑:这个问题假设我必须作为一个应用程序来做这个。我知道只提供 mp3 并让用户 iPhone/Android/Blackberry Media Player 处理它们可能会好得多,但出于我的目的,这些解决方案超出了这个问题的框架。

0 投票
3 回答
369 浏览

database - asynchttp 和 rhomobile

如何在 rhomobile 应用程序中显示 JSON 数据而不将其保存到数据库?

谢谢

0 投票
1 回答
711 浏览

ruby-on-rails - Ruby Rhodes 中的模型基本问题

我是 Rhodes 的新手,对 RoR 没有任何经验。

我在我的应用程序中创建了一个新模型:rhogen 模型 CoffeeKind name,description,vendor,picture

我想:

  1. 添加新属性(“尺寸”)

  2. 从这个模型中引用另一个模型(“供应商”引用 CoffeeVendor)

  3. 从 json 导入各种咖啡种类

我有使用 Python / Django / Google App Engine 的经验,但没有使用 Ruby / RoR。

如何执行上述任务?或者我在哪里可以寻求帮助?我尝试谷歌搜索并查看文档但一无所获:/

帮助!:)

(我在其中添加了 ruby​​ on rails 标签,因为我听说它类似于 Rhodes)